Cricket Live Line on 24 Feb 25Afghanistan and South Africa will square off in an exciting Group B match at the National Bank Stadium in Karachi on February 21 as part of the ICC Champions Trophy 2025. Afghanistan is playing in the Champions Trophy for the first time, and South Africa is looking to build on their recent success in ICC competitions. Afghanistan vs South Africa CT 2025 Schedule Date: February 21, 2025 Time: 2:30 PM IST (Toss at 2:00 PM IST) Venue: National Bank Stadium, Karachi The batting-friendly surface of Karachi's National Bank Stadium has long been known for its steady bounce, which promotes stroke play. Later in the match, spinners might get help. A high-scoring match could be on the cards because of the predicted bright skies and pleasant weather. Afghanistan receives its first taste of the Champions Trophy following their recent surge in the ICC competitions. Although they aren't the clear favorites, they can certainly take the giants by storm. However, it is South Africa's responsibility to go beyond their obstacles and do well during the competition. South Africa against Afghanistan Which team will win AFG vs. SA? South Africa comes into the game with a strong team and a track record of winning ICC tournaments, including making it to the 2024 T20 World Cup final and the 2023 ODI World Cup semifinals. They have an advantage because of their well-balanced team. But Afghanistan's ascent in international cricket, displayed by their strong spin attack and previous upsets of elite nations, indicates they should not be taken lightly. How well Afghanistan's batsmen manage South Africa's pace attack and how well their spinners can put South Africa's hitters on the defensive could determine the result. AFG vs. SA Who Will Win: We believe Afghanistan can pull off a huge upset and deal the Proteas a serious setback, even though South Africa will be the clear favorite to win. Match Preview: The Champions Trophy has already started, with India (IND) and Bangladesh (BAN) playing their next match on February 20 at the Dubai International Stadium. The erratic underdogs and the two-time Champions Trophy winners will square off in this matchup. In their most recent ODI series, the Indian squad defeated the Three Lions 3-0 at home against England. Even though they have been hurt by the fact that top bowler Jasprit Bumrah is not able to play in the event, they still have a strong team and will be hoping to win the first game. The Indian squad has won their most recent ODI series, whereas the Bangladeshi team has struggled in the 50-over format, losing their last two series. Afghanistan and the West Indies defeated the Bangladeshi side in the ODI series, and their standing in the ICC ODI rankings does not appear to be good. For the Tigers to establish themselves as a premier international team, they will need to win some games. Match Details: Match: India vs Bangladesh, Match 2, Champions Trophy 2025 Venue: Dubai International Stadium, Dubai Date & Time: Thursday, February 20, 2025, 2:30 PM (IST) Live Broadcast: JioHotstar, Sports18/Star Sports Network Dubai International Stadium Pitch Report: The Dubai International Cricket Stadium's pitch usually benefits hitters, especially during the second inning. The new ball may provide some seam movement for pacers at first, but as the game progresses, conditions for batters improve and they are able to play with greater freedom. If the surface slows down in the middle overs, spinners will find a grip. Furthermore, because the game is being played under lights, dew may have a big effect on the bowlers' grip.
